/*
* Copyright (c) 2005, 2018 IBM Corporation, CEA, and others.
* All rights reserved. This program and the accompanying materials
* are made available under the terms of the Eclipse Public License v2.0
* which accompanies this distribution, and is available at
* http://www.eclipse.org/legal/epl-v20.html
*
* Contributors:
* IBM - initial API and implementation
* Kenn Hussey (CEA) - 327039, 351774, 418466, 451350, 485756
* Kenn Hussey - 535301
*
*/
package org.eclipse.uml2.uml.internal.operations;
import java.util.Map;
import org.eclipse.emf.common.util.BasicDiagnostic;
import org.eclipse.emf.common.util.Diagnostic;
import org.eclipse.emf.common.util.DiagnosticChain;
import org.eclipse.uml2.uml.Activity;
import org.eclipse.uml2.uml.util.UMLValidator;
/**
* <!-- begin-user-doc -->
* A static utility class that provides operations related to '<em><b>Activity</b></em>' model objects.
* <!-- end-user-doc -->
*
* <p>
* The following operations are supported:
* </p>
* <ul>
* <li>{@link org.eclipse.uml2.uml.Activity#validateMaximumOneParameterNode(org.eclipse.emf.common.util.DiagnosticChain, java.util.Map) <em>Validate Maximum One Parameter Node</em>}</li>
* <li>{@link org.eclipse.uml2.uml.Activity#validateMaximumTwoParameterNodes(org.eclipse.emf.common.util.DiagnosticChain, java.util.Map) <em>Validate Maximum Two Parameter Nodes</em>}</li>
* </ul>
*
* @generated
*/
public class ActivityOperations
extends BehaviorOperations {
/**
* <!-- begin-user-doc -->
* <!-- end-user-doc -->
* @generated
*/
protected ActivityOperations() {
super();
}
/**
* <!-- begin-user-doc -->
* <!-- end-user-doc -->
* <!-- begin-model-doc -->
* A Parameter with direction other than inout must have exactly one ActivityParameterNode in an Activity.
* ownedParameter->forAll(p |
* p.direction <> ParameterDirectionKind::inout implies node->select(
* oclIsKindOf(ActivityParameterNode) and oclAsType(ActivityParameterNode).parameter = p)->size()= 1)
* @param activity The receiving '<em><b>Activity</b></em>' model object.
* @param diagnostics The chain of diagnostics to which problems are to be appended.
* @param context The cache of context-specific information.
* <!-- end-model-doc -->
* @generated
*/
public static boolean validateMaximumOneParameterNode(Activity activity,
DiagnosticChain diagnostics, Map<Object, Object> context) {
// TODO: implement this method
// -> specify the condition that violates the invariant
// -> verify the details of the diagnostic, including severity and message
// Ensure that you remove @generated or mark it @generated NOT
if (false) {
if (diagnostics != null) {
diagnostics.add(new BasicDiagnostic(Diagnostic.ERROR,
UMLValidator.DIAGNOSTIC_SOURCE,
UMLValidator.ACTIVITY__MAXIMUM_ONE_PARAMETER_NODE,
org.eclipse.emf.ecore.plugin.EcorePlugin.INSTANCE.getString(
"_UI_GenericInvariant_diagnostic", //$NON-NLS-1$
new Object[]{"validateMaximumOneParameterNode", //$NON-NLS-1$
org.eclipse.emf.ecore.util.EObjectValidator
.getObjectLabel(activity, context)}), new Object[]{activity}));
}
return false;
}
return true;
}
/**
* <!-- begin-user-doc -->
* <!-- end-user-doc -->
* <!-- begin-model-doc -->
* A Parameter with direction inout must have exactly two ActivityParameterNodes in an Activity, at most one with incoming ActivityEdges and at most one with outgoing ActivityEdges.
* ownedParameter->forAll(p |
* p.direction = ParameterDirectionKind::inout implies
* let associatedNodes : Set(ActivityNode) = node->select(
* oclIsKindOf(ActivityParameterNode) and oclAsType(ActivityParameterNode).parameter = p) in
* associatedNodes->size()=2 and
* associatedNodes->select(incoming->notEmpty())->size()<=1 and
* associatedNodes->select(outgoing->notEmpty())->size()<=1
* )
* @param activity The receiving '<em><b>Activity</b></em>' model object.
* @param diagnostics The chain of diagnostics to which problems are to be appended.
* @param context The cache of context-specific information.
* <!-- end-model-doc -->
* @generated
*/
public static boolean validateMaximumTwoParameterNodes(Activity activity,
DiagnosticChain diagnostics, Map<Object, Object> context) {
// TODO: implement this method
// -> specify the condition that violates the invariant
// -> verify the details of the diagnostic, including severity and message
// Ensure that you remove @generated or mark it @generated NOT
if (false) {
if (diagnostics != null) {
diagnostics.add(new BasicDiagnostic(Diagnostic.ERROR,
UMLValidator.DIAGNOSTIC_SOURCE,
UMLValidator.ACTIVITY__MAXIMUM_TWO_PARAMETER_NODES,
org.eclipse.emf.ecore.plugin.EcorePlugin.INSTANCE.getString(
"_UI_GenericInvariant_diagnostic", //$NON-NLS-1$
new Object[]{"validateMaximumTwoParameterNodes", //$NON-NLS-1$
org.eclipse.emf.ecore.util.EObjectValidator
.getObjectLabel(activity, context)}), new Object[]{activity}));
}
return false;
}
return true;
}
} // ActivityOperations
